Little space heating systems are generally used when the primary heating system is not available, insufficient, or when main heating is as well expensive to install or run. Sometimes, tiny space heaters can be less pricey to make use of if you only wish to heat one room or supplement poor heating in one area.
Small area heaters work by convection (the flow of air in a room) or glowing home heating. Radiant heaters release infrared radiation that straight heats objects and individuals within their find more information line of vision, and are a more effective option when you will certainly remain in a space for just a couple of hours and can stay within the line of view of the heating system.
Safety and security is a top consideration when utilizing little room heating units. The United State Consumer Product Security Payment estimates that more than 1,700 residential fires each year are linked with using room heaters, leading to even more than 80 fatalities and 160 injuries nationally - 1 Source Portable Air. Space heating unit capabilities usually range between 10,000 Btu and 40,000 Btu per hour, and typically operate on electricity, propane, gas, and kerosene (see wood and pellet heating for information on wood and pellet stoves). These heating systems are full of oil and have metal fins to radiate the warmth. They are frequently called "radiator heating units" because they resemble conventional radiators located in older residences. They should be connected into an electric energy resource for the oil to be heated up inside the device. You do not need to change the oil at any moment.
One more pro is that they're silent, unlike fan-based space heaters. These heating systems are warm to the touch, making it easy for pet dogs, kids, and grownups to mistakenly burn themselves. Likewise, because the oil is combustible, there's always the risk of the gadget catching fire. Tipping is a specifically typical fire hazard, however several newer room heaters have an automatic shut-off when tipping is identified.
